
在如今的移动应用市场中,很多开发者会选择通过多个平台发布自己的App,比如各大应用商店、官网、第三方平台等。但这样做时,一个常见的问题就是:如何保证各个渠道发布的App签名一致?
首先,我们先来简单了解一下什么是“签名”。App的签名就像是它的“身份证”,用来验证这个App是否来自可信的开发者。如果签名不一致,系统可能会认为这个App是被篡改过的,甚至可能无法安装或运行。
那么,为什么要在不同渠道分发App时保持签名一致呢?原因很简单:用户信任和安全。如果你在不同的平台上下载同一个App,但签名不一样,用户可能会担心是不是被“换皮”了,或者是不是有安全隐患。
那怎么才能做到签名一致呢?
最简单的方法就是:使用同一个证书文件(keystore)来签名所有版本的App。这个证书文件就像是你的“钥匙”,只有你拥有它,才能为App签名。只要你在每个渠道发布App时都用这把“钥匙”,就能保证签名一致。
不过,有些开发者可能会担心:如果我把证书文件给其他平台,会不会被滥用?其实,只要你不把证书文件随意分享出去,就不用担心这个问题。同时,现在很多平台也支持开发者自行上传签名证书,这样你就完全掌握主动权。
另外,还可以通过一些工具或平台来统一管理签名过程。例如,有些打包平台会提供一键生成签名的功能,这样你就不用自己手动操作,省心又省力。
总之,确保签名一致的关键在于:使用同一份证书、不随意泄露信息、合理利用工具辅助。只要你注意这些小细节,就能在多个渠道分发App的同时,保障用户的信任和安全性。
https://www.hainrtvu.com/oqwgn/143.html最后提醒一下,虽然多渠道分发能带来更多的曝光,但也需要谨慎对待每一个环节,尤其是签名问题,不能马虎。这样才能真正实现“正版分发”,让用户安心使用。